Late Victorian Hair

 

 

 

Products used:
Curling iron
Hair grips
Hairband
Pintail comb














Method
To begin with, section the front of the hair from the back of the hair, and then section the front of the hair down the middle and secure these so that you can work on them later. At the back, create a horseshoe shape and create a ponytail with a quarter of the back section of the hair. Then separate the ponytail into 3 sections, curl each one and roll them towards the head and pin, making sure that they aren't very symmetrical as you want the hair to look as if it has been piled upon the head. Then, take sections from below, curl them and do the same, pinning them towards the middle of the head and going down to create this look. However when close to the bottom, curl the sections of the hair that are left and pin them to the head from about halfway down the section of the hair so the rest of the section can flow down as this was the look in the late Victorian era. Now with the front sections of the hair, curl them towards the middle, twist them and pin them to the piles at the back of the head.
